In a strategic move to advance its chiplet-based architecture, Tenstorrent announced the acquisition of Blue Cheetah Analog Design, a startup specializing in highly-customized analog and mixed-signal intellectual property (IP). Blue Cheetah has long served as a trusted partner to Tenstorrent, playing a key role in developing cutting-edge interconnect solutions for its AI and RISC-V chiplet products.

This acquisition builds upon a previous collaboration, where Tenstorrent licensed Blue Cheetah’s die-to-die (D2D) interconnect IP to support the development of its modular silicon solutions. Bringing Blue Cheetah’s analog and mixed-signal innovation in-house will significantly accelerate Tenstorrent’s efforts to deliver high-performance, energy-efficient AI systems powered by chiplet technology.

As chiplet adoption grows, the importance of seamless, high-speed interconnects has become paramount. Blue Cheetah’s deep expertise in analog/mixed-signal design is expected to directly enhance Tenstorrent’s roadmap, providing the precision and performance required to meet the increasing demands of modern AI workloads. The acquisition also supports Tenstorrent’s long-term goal of fostering an open chiplet ecosystem, leveraging interoperable interconnects tailored to each chiplet socket.

Led by co-founder and CEO Dr. Elad Alon, a renowned figure in analog design and the technical lead behind the Bunch of Wires (BoW) PHY standard, Blue Cheetah has built a strong engineering and leadership team. The group brings a unique blend of traditional circuit design experience and advanced design automation capabilities. Their collective expertise spans a wide array of technologies including D2D, DDR, and SerDes—critical components for Tenstorrent’s next-generation product strategy.

Blue Cheetah’s interconnect IP solutions are compatible across multiple foundries and process nodes. The company’s flagship product, BlueLynx, delivers a complete D2D interconnect subsystem—including PHY and link layer components—supporting industry standards such as Open Compute Project’s BoW and Universal Chiplet Interconnect Express (UCIe).

“Blue Cheetah shares our vision to build simple and comparable chiplet ecosystems,” said Jim Keller, CEO of Tenstorrent. “We’re looking forward to the next chapter of accelerating AI with open standards and high-performance IP.”

“As a customer and partner, Tenstorrent collaborated closely with Blue Cheetah to realize the full benefits of our BlueLynx technology in their chiplet products,” added Dr. Elad Alon, CEO of Blue Cheetah. “The Blue Cheetah team looks forward to amplifying our impact by joining with Tenstorrent to provide both leading IP and chiplets/chiplet ecosystems critical to the continued progression of AI.”

With this acquisition, Tenstorrent positions itself to further drive innovation in AI hardware by integrating core interconnect technologies essential for scalable and interoperable chiplet systems.
